I think a beneficial feature would to be able to change the text color for the percentages denoting the percentage of responses that are high or low. This may help with audience comprehension of what the percentages denote. For example, in the below example, if the numbers on the right for 68% and 49% are red and the numbers on the left for 23% and 38% are blue, that may be useful for presenting the data so audiences may grasp that the left percentages are matched to low responses and the right percentages are matched to high responses.
Is there any way to accomplish this with the likert package? If not, could this be additionally functionality that is added later on?
